Talking Texas Art: The Panhandle

Glasstire has announced the second installment of its "Talking Texas Art" panel series, scheduled for April 23, 2026, at the Louise Hopkins Underwood Center for the Arts (LHUCA) in Lubbock. Part of the publication’s 25th-anniversary celebrations, the event focuses on the Texas Panhandle's creative landscape. The panel features prominent regional figures including Judy Tedford Deaton of The Grace Museum, Jon Revett and Amy Von Lintel of West Texas A&M University, and Charles Adams of CASP, moderated by Glasstire’s William Sarradet.

Top Five: April 9, 2026

Glasstire has released its weekly 'Top Five' list of essential art exhibitions across Texas for April 2026. The selection highlights a diverse range of regional talent, including a group show at the Rubin Center in El Paso focused on Chihuahuan Desert ecology, a 50-year retrospective of digital pioneers MANUAL at Moody Gallery in Houston, and a lifetime survey of Vietnam veteran and educator Hector Homero Rubio in Corpus Christi. Other featured shows include Freddy Ortega’s MFA thesis at TCU and Juan Pablo Hernandez’s multimedia glasswork.
